While the Kentucky Wildcats were struggling their way through a 33-18 loss to Georgia Tech in Saturday’s TaxSlayer Bowl, one former Kentucky coach was possibly reveling in the Wildcats’ misery.

Rich Brooks, who coached at the school from 2003 to 2009, chimed in during the game with an odd tweet thanking his 2006, 2007 and 2008 Kentucky squads for actually winning their bowl games:

The 2016 season marked the first time since 2010 that the Wildcats managed to qualify for a bowl game, so things are starting to look up for Mark Stoops and his squad.

Whether Brooks meant his tweet as a jab at the 2016 team or not, he did follow it up with some praise for Stoops and the work he did in 2016:

Maybe next year, the Wildcats can do what Brooks’s squads did and earn a bowl-game victory.
